FC Bayern Munich is to plan a European Premier League together with other European heavyweights.
Spain's league president thinks the idea is destructive.
FC Bayern Munich *
: The
Bundesliga record champions *
should
think
about a European
Premier League
together with
Liverpool FC
,
Manchester United
and other clubs
.
In this
super league
, around five billion euros are to be distributed.
The start could be in 2022.
UEFA is
not very enthusiastic
about an
alternative to the Champions League
- the national leagues are also fighting back.

Are the top European clubs serious and are planning a parallel competition to the Champions League *?
The media reports on the mind games at
FC Bayern Munich
and other heavyweights in Europe not only frighten football fans, but also at UEFA, the recent rumors are likely to be viewed with suspicion.
FC Bayern and Co. in a Super League?
"It just looks good in a bar at 5 a.m."
In a statement, the
Continental Football Association commented
on the plans for a new super league: "The UEFA President has made it clear on many occasions that he is strongly against a super league," a spokesman told the
BBC
, which was not surprising
.
After all, no less a person than the world governing body
FIFA should
promote such considerations in order to develop new sources of income.

FIFA itself is keeping a low profile, but at least the question of financing seems to have already been specified: The Wall Street bank JP Morgan is reportedly responsible for
monetizing the competition
.
Aside from UEFA, the national leagues have little interest in a new Super League either.
Javier Tebas, President of Spain's
La Liga
, also made a
clear statement
on the
BBC
:
“The originators of this idea show a total ignorance of the organization and customers of European and global football.” Tebas predicts enormous economic damage - also for the clubs themselves - and expresses a lack of understanding: “These underground projects only look good if you think about them in the morning
at 5 a.m.
thinks
in a bar
. "

Original message from October 20:
Is there a risk of a mega-row in international football?
Several top clubs around
FC Bayern Munich
*
,
Jürgen Klopps FC Liverpool
and
Manchester United
are allegedly planning a
European Premier League
very intensively
.
Namely under the umbrella of the world association Fifa.
The European
Uefa
, however, should be left out.
The
sports buzzer
writes on Tuesday
evening
and refers to a corresponding report from
Sky Sports
.
Accordingly, the clubs involved should currently push ahead with the plans.
The ideas would include a distribution of
five billion euros
, it is said.
Up to 18 teams should take part in the
Super League
.
The mode therefore provides for return games.
It is not just this fact that is likely to cause great trouble.
Finally, an appropriate competition would be the
Champions League
the
UEFA
devalue.
And: Most recently, the CEO of
FC Bayern
*
,
Karl-Heinz Rummenigge
, repeatedly affirmed that he
would remain loyal to
the
German Bundesliga
*
.
FC Bayern in the European super league?
The reaction of the German Bundesliga would be exciting
Whether a
European Premier League would be
in the interests of the
German Football League (DFL)
, however, should be an exciting question.
According to
Sky Sports,
the new league could start
in 2022.
